\"Summer<\/a>Donna Reish, curriculum author and parenting\/homeschool speaker, answers readers\u2019 questions about bringing an elementary student up to grade level in reading during the summer. In this episode, Donna helps parents learn what to focus on in bringing their child to reading fluency, including terminology, phonics programs, reader selections, and steps in helping children learn to read during the summer school break. She has many links to help parents find the phonics program, readers, and methods that will work best for them and their children.<\/p>\n
